The purpose of the aerator supplier is to add dissolved oxygen to the water. This involves two aspects of oxygen solubility and dissolution rate. The former includes three factors: water temperature, water salinity and oxygen partial pressure. The latter includes three factors: the degree of unsaturation of dissolved oxygen, the contact area and method of water vapor, and the state of water movement.
A stable state of water in which the water temperature and the salt content of the water. Therefore, in order to increase oxygen to the water body, it is necessary to directly or indirectly change the three factors of oxygen partial pressure, water-gas contact area and method, and water movement status. 1. The aerator supplier uses mechanical parts to stir the water to promote flow exchange and interface update.
2. Disperse the water into fine mist droplets and spray the gas phase to increase the contact area of water vapor.
3. Inhale under negative pressure, disperse the gas into micro-bubbles, and then press it into the water.
Suppliers of various types of aerators are designed and manufactured based on these principles. They either take one measure to promote oxygen dissolution, or take two or more measures.
